Page MenuHomePhabricator

Remove VotableInterface from PonderQuestion

Authored by chad on Aug 9 2015, 1:57 AM.
Referenced Files
Unknown Object (File)
Mon, Feb 24, 11:54 PM
Unknown Object (File)
Mon, Feb 24, 11:36 PM
Unknown Object (File)
Sat, Feb 22, 12:10 AM
Unknown Object (File)
Fri, Feb 21, 10:51 PM
Unknown Object (File)
Tue, Feb 18, 2:58 AM
Unknown Object (File)
Tue, Feb 11, 9:49 PM
Unknown Object (File)
Sun, Feb 9, 9:39 PM
Unknown Object (File)
Sun, Feb 9, 9:39 PM



Ref T6920, This removes the PonderVotableInterface from PonderQuestion and assocaited code. Also... never used?

Test Plan

Visit Ponder, See List, New Question, Add Answer.

Diff Detail

rP Phabricator
Lint Passed
Tests Passed
Build Status
Buildable 7546
Build 8132: [Placeholder Plan] Wait for 30 Seconds
Build 8131: arc lint + arc unit

Event Timeline

chad retitled this revision from to Remove VotableInterface from PonderQuestion.
chad updated this object.
chad edited the test plan for this revision. (Show Details)
chad added a reviewer: epriestley.

Should I also write a script to clean out edge/edgedata?

epriestley edited edge metadata.

You can just write a .sql file which does this, I think:

/* Removes Ponder vote data. */

  WHERE type IN (17, 18, 19, 20);

  WHERE type IN (17, 18, 19, 20);

That should get rid of everything without requiring a messier/more complicated migration (that also gets rid of the answer votes).

However, it might be good to wait a month or so to do this, just in case someone really wants their vote data. Keeping the edges around for a bit won't hurt anything.

This revision is now accepted and ready to land.Aug 9 2015, 3:26 AM

I think I'm just going to convert the +1 answer votes as 'helpfuls' and drop everything else, but good idea on keeping the data for now.

This revision was automatically updated to reflect the committed changes.